Rod-Style Actuators
Rodless Cylinders


Larger footprint: for a typical NFPA tie rod cylinder, 2" bore x 8" stroke, OAL when rod is extended is 21.75 in. (appr.)


The equivalent 2" bore x 8" stroke Tol-O-Matic rodless cylinder (BC220 series) is 14.3 in. Since the cylinder stroke is contained within the cylinder itself, there is a 34% smaller footprint! (Space savings varies with style and stoke selection.)


 

Minimal load support, especially when approaching end of stroke. The bending moment can cause seal and bearing wear and load deflection. (See the nervous fish.)

Load is supported throughout the entire stroke length. Using Tol-O-Matic’s sizing and selection software, My, Mx, and Mz are calculated and used to select the best rodless cylinder for the application. (See happy fish.)


 
Unequal piston areas; annular area effects force output, which is not equal in both directions. Example: 2" bore rod-style cylinder with 5/8" rod diameter exerts a theoretical 314.2 lbs of force extending, and 283.5 lbs retracting using 100 PSI—a 9.8% reduction. This effect is exaggerated with larger rod diameters: a 1" rod diameter on this 2" bore cylinder only exerts 236 lbs when retracting—a 25% reduction in force! Rodless cylinders have equal piston areas in both directions. There is no need to size the cylinder up to accommodate load variation in either direction. Machine design is optimized.

 

Rod rotation is a possibility, creating potentially unstable load control. (Now the fish are VERY nervous!)

Depending upon the product series selected, the load is generously supported through the stroke length with no possibility of rod rotation. (Happy, happy fish!)
